聚集网(jujiwang.com) - 收录免费分类目录信息软文发布网址提交
免费加入

JavaScript鼠标事件详解:让你的网页动起来 (javascript)

文章编号:9503时间:2024-09-26人气:


javascript

鼠标事件是 JavaScript 中的重要工具,它允许您响应用户与网页中的元素之间的交互。通过处理这些事件,您可以创建交互式和动态的网页,让用户更好地参与并与您的内容互动。

常见的鼠标事件

有几种常见的鼠标事件,您可以在网页中使用它们:

  • onclick:当用户单击元素时触发。
  • 让你的网页动起来
  • ondblclick:当用户双击元素时触发。
  • onmousemove:当用户在元素上移动鼠标时触发。
  • onmouseover:当用户将鼠标悬停在元素上时触发。
  • onmouseout:当用户将鼠标从元素上移开时触发。
  • onmousedown:当用户按下元素上的鼠标按钮时触发。
  • onmouseup:当用户释放元素上的鼠标按钮时触发。

使用鼠标事件

要使用鼠标事件,您需要将事件侦听器附加到要处理事件的元素。您可以使用以下语法

element.addEventListener("event_name", function() {// 要执行的代码 });

例如,要处理单击事件,您可以使用以下代码:

document.querySelector("my_button").addEventListener("click", function() {alert("按钮已单击!"); });

鼠标事件属性

当鼠标事件触发时,它会创建一个事件对象,其中包含有关鼠标交互的各种信息。您可以使用以下属性访问这些信息:

  • clientX:鼠标在浏览器窗口中相对于水平边缘的 X 坐标。
  • clientY:鼠标在浏览器窗口中相对于


相关标签: JavaScript鼠标事件详解让你的网页动起来javascript

上一篇:掌握鼠标事件编程的艺术创建引人入胜的交互

下一篇:揭秘鼠标事件的幕后秘诀处理点击移动和悬停

内容声明:

1、本站收录的内容来源于大数据收集,版权归原网站所有!
2、本站收录的内容若侵害到您的利益,请联系我们进行删除处理!
3、本站不接受违法信息,如您发现违法内容,请联系我们进行举报处理!
4、本文地址:http://www.jujiwang.com/article/fdaad88cff644dacef7b.html,复制请保留版权链接!


温馨小提示:在您的网站做上本站友情链接,访问一次即可自动收录并自动排在本站第一位!
随机文章
分步指南:将数据源绑定到 ASP.NET DropdownList 控件

分步指南:将数据源绑定到 ASP.NET DropdownList 控件

本文提供了一个分步指南,介绍如何将数据源绑定到ASP.NETDropdownList控件,DropdownList控件允许用户从预定义列表中选择一个项目,步骤1,创建ASP.NETWeb项目打开VisualStudio,单击,文件,菜单,然后单击,新建,>,项目,在,新建项目,对话框中,选择,VisualC,>,Web,...。

技术教程 2024-09-16 22:40:41

优化ForEach循环性能:提高PHP脚本效率的技巧 (优化for循环)

优化ForEach循环性能:提高PHP脚本效率的技巧 (优化for循环)

引言ForEach循环在PHP中是一种用于遍历数组或对象的常见方法,如果没有对其进行优化,它可能会导致性能下降,特别是当遍历大量数据时,本文将介绍几种优化ForEach循环性能的技巧,以提高PHP脚本的效率,1.使用缩短的语法PHP5.5以后的版本支持缩短的ForEach语法,它可以改善性能,缩短的语法如下,```phpforeach...。

技术教程 2024-09-15 13:12:59

征服未定义错误:提升你作为开发人员的能力 (征服未定义错误怎么办)

征服未定义错误:提升你作为开发人员的能力 (征服未定义错误怎么办)

作为一名开发人员,你可能会经常遇到未定义错误,这可能会让人感到沮丧,这些错误是软件开发过程中不可避免的一部分,重要的是要知道如何解决它们,本文将探讨如何征服未定义错误,提升你的开发人员能力,了解未定义错误未定义错误是发生在运行时或编译时的错误,表明代码中存在无法确定的问题,它们通常是由以下原因引起的,变量或函数未定义参数传递不正确语法...。

最新资讯 2024-09-15 01:14:41

单选按钮和复选框:深入比较差异和何时使用哪种控件 (单选按钮和复选按钮)

单选按钮和复选框:深入比较差异和何时使用哪种控件 (单选按钮和复选按钮)

单选按钮和复选框是两种常见的文件输入控件,用于收集用户输入,它们具有不同的目的,并且在不同的场景中使用,单选按钮单选按钮用于允许用户从一组选项中选择一个,它们通常用于当用户需要在互斥的选项之间进行选择时,例如,在询问用户的性别或他们最喜欢的颜色时,可以使用单选按钮,单选按钮通常显示为一组圆圈或方块,当用户单击一个单选按钮时,它会被选中...。

互联网资讯 2024-09-14 17:53:53

增强洞察力:通过数据可视化,我们可以深入了解数据,发现隐藏的模式和关系,这有助于我们在竞争中获得优势。(增强洞察力)

增强洞察力:通过数据可视化,我们可以深入了解数据,发现隐藏的模式和关系,这有助于我们在竞争中获得优势。(增强洞察力)

增强洞察力,数据可视化提升决策力引言在当今数据驱动的时代,数据可视化已成为企业和组织获取竞争优势的关键工具,通过将复杂的数据转换为直观的视觉表现,数据可视化使我们能够深入了解数据,发现隐藏的模式和关系,从而做出明智的决策,数据可视化的优势增强洞察力数据可视化允许我们探索大量数据,识别趋势、异常值和关联性,视觉表示可以帮助我们快速理解数...。

技术教程 2024-09-14 17:38:13

无孤儿清除:理解无孤儿清除概念及其在 (无父母的孤儿)

无孤儿清除:理解无孤儿清除概念及其在 (无父母的孤儿)

父母的孤儿进程的关键机制,有助于保持系统稳定性、防止资源泄漏并增强安全性,通过在,无父母的孤儿,设计模式中实现无孤儿清除,可以确保子进程在父进程退出时得到正确管理,从而创建一个更可靠且健壮的系统,...。

最新资讯 2024-09-13 23:07:02

阶乘函数在数学中的应用:从排列和组合到分析 (阶乘函数怎么求导)

阶乘函数在数学中的应用:从排列和组合到分析 (阶乘函数怎么求导)

引言阶乘函数是一个基本而重要的数学函数,它定义为正整数n的阶乘是所有小于或等于n的正整数的乘积,阶乘函数通常表示为n,例如,5,被计算为5×4×3×2×1=120,阶乘函数在数学的许多领域都有应用,包括排列和组合、分析学、概率论和统计学,本文将探讨阶乘函数的一些主要应用,并重点介绍求阶乘函数导数的方法,排列和组合阶乘函数在排列和组合...。

互联网资讯 2024-09-11 10:51:09

人工智能和机器学习(人工智能和机器人的区别)

人工智能和机器学习(人工智能和机器人的区别)

人工智能与机器学习,深入浅出前言人工智能,AI,和机器学习,ML,是当今科技领域备受关注的热门话题,这两项技术紧密相关,但又各有不同,了解它们之间的区别对于理解人工智能的广泛潜力至关重要,本文将深入探讨人工智能和机器学习,并阐明它们之间的关键差异,人工智能,AI,定义,人工智能是赋予机器执行通常需要人类智能的任务的能力,例如解决问题、...。

技术教程 2024-09-08 13:14:50

通过 Java 定时器监控和故障排除: 维护应用程序稳定性和及时解决问题 (通过JavaScript输出告警消息框)

通过 Java 定时器监控和故障排除: 维护应用程序稳定性和及时解决问题 (通过JavaScript输出告警消息框)

在Java应用程序中,定时器是一个有价值的工具,可用于定期执行任务、监控系统并故障排除问题,通过在应用程序中实现定时器,您可以主动识别潜在问题并立即解决它们,从而维护应用程序的稳定性和及时解决问题,实现Java定时器在Java中,可以使用java.util.Timer类创建和管理定时器,以下是创建和计划定时器的步骤,创建Timer对象...。

技术教程 2024-09-07 18:01:36

正则表达式:理解复杂模式匹配的强大工具 (正则表达式语法大全)

正则表达式:理解复杂模式匹配的强大工具 (正则表达式语法大全)

概述正则表达式,regularexpressions,简称regex,是一种强大的语言模式匹配工具,它允许您使用一系列规则描述要查找的字符串或文本模式,正则表达式广泛应用于各种领域,包括,文本处理和数据提取表单验证密码强度检查网络爬虫自然语言处理正则表达式语法正则表达式语法遵循一组规则,用于指定要匹配的字符串模式,元字符说明匹配除换行...。

技术教程 2024-09-07 10:56:21

成为MATLAB递归函数大师:掌握其复杂性,实现高效的算法 (成为茅山大师兄石坚的小说)

成为MATLAB递归函数大师:掌握其复杂性,实现高效的算法 (成为茅山大师兄石坚的小说)

前言递归函数在编程中是一种强大的工具,可用于解决各种问题,在MATLAB中,递归函数的使用尤其广泛,因为其简洁的语法和强大的计算能力,掌握递归函数的复杂性对于编写高效和可维护的代码至关重要,本文将深入探究MATLAB递归函数的复杂性,并提供实用技巧,帮助您成为一名熟练的递归函数大师,递归函数的复杂性递归函数的复杂性通常由其递归深度和每...。

本站公告 2024-09-07 05:58:42

网站开发的捷径:织梦CMS源码下载与安装教程 (网站开发网站)

网站开发的捷径:织梦CMS源码下载与安装教程 (网站开发网站)

对于初学者来说,网站开发可能是一项艰巨且耗时的任务,但是,有了内容管理系统,CMS,,事情会变得简单得多,CMS是一种软件,可让您轻松创建、管理和更新网站内容,而无需复杂的编程知识,织梦CMS是国内最受欢迎的开源CMS之一,因其强大功能、易用性和广泛的可扩展性而备受推崇,在本教程中,我们将引导您完成织梦CMS源码下载和安装的详细步骤,...。

互联网资讯 2024-09-05 13:58:13